Abstract

Official abstract text for this publication.

A roll unit includes a feeding roller to which a belt-shaped member is wound, and a winding roller to which the belt-shaped member fed from the feeding roll is wound. One of the feeding roller and the winding roller is relatively movable to the other of the feeding roller and the winding roller.

What is claimed is: 1. A head maintenance device to maintain a liquid discharge head to discharge a liquid from nozzles, the head maintenance device comprising: a roll device, the roll device comprising: a roll unit comprising: a feeding roller to which a belt-shaped member is wound; and a winding roller to which the belt-shaped member fed from the feeding roller is wound, one of the feeding roller and the winding roller being relatively movable to the other of the feeding roller and the winding roller, and being movably held in the roll unit, the feeding roller and the winding roller being arranged such that, as the belt-shaped member is wound, the one of the feeding roller and the winding roller is moved depending on a diameter of a roll composed of the other of the feeding roller and the winding roller and of a portion of the belt-shaped member wound on the other of the feeding roller and the winding roller, wherein the belt-shaped member is a wiping member to perform wiping, and wherein the roll unit is operative to wipe a surface of the liquid discharge head on which the nozzles are formed with the wiping member. 2.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is relatively movable in an obliquely upward direction away from the other of the feeding roller and the winding roller. 3.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is movable in a horizontal direction, and the roll unit further comprising an urging member to push the one of the feeding roller and the winding roller close to other of the feeding roller and the winding roller. 4.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is movable in a vertical direction, and a lowest position of the one of the feeding roller and the winding roller is disposed higher than the other of the feeding roller and the winding roller. 5.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is movable in a vertical direction, a highest position of the one of the feeding roller and the winding roller is disposed lower than the other of the feeding roller and the winding roller, and the roll unit further comprising an urging member to push the one of the feeding roller and the winding roller upward. 6.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is movable in an obliquely downward direction away from the other of the feeding roller and the winding roller, and the roll unit further comprising an urging member to push the one of the feeding roller and the winding roller obliquely upward. 7. The head maintenance device according to claim 1 , further comprising a partition movably disposed between the feeding roller and the winding roller. 8. The head maintenance device according to claim 1 , wherein the belt-shaped member is a wiping member to perform wiping. 9. The head maintenance device according to claim 1 , wherein the roll device further comprises a movable platform detachably mounting the roll unit to move the roll unit. 10. A liquid discharge apparatus comprising: the liquid discharge head to discharge the liquid from the nozzles; and the head maintenance device according to claim 1 . 11. The head maintenance device according to claim 1 , further comprising a partition disposed between the feeding roller and the winding roller, wherein the partition is displaced and deformed according to a decrease or an increase in an outer diameter of a feeding roll formed by the belt-shaped member wound around the feeding roller and a winding roll formed by the belt-shaped member wound around the winding roller. 12. The head maintenance device according to claim 1 , wherein the one of the feeding roller and the winding roller is relatively movable to the other of the feeding roller and the winding roller such that a distance between an axial center of the feeding roller and an axial center of the feeding roller can change. 13. The head maintenance device according to claim 1 , further comprising: a feeding roll formed by the belt-shaped member wound around the feeding roller; and a winding roll formed by the belt-shaped member wound around the winding roller, wherein, in an initial state, an outer diameter of the feeding roll is a maximum, and a distance between an axial center of the feeding roller and an axial center of the winding roller is a minimum axial-center distance, wherein, during winding of the belt-shaped member on to the winding roller, an outer periphery of the winding roll contacts an outer periphery of the feeding roll, and the distance between the axial center of the feeding roller and the axial center of the winding roller varies and is greater than the minimum axial-center distance, and wherein the distance between the axial center of the feeding roller and the axial center of the winding roller is a maximum axial-center distance when an outer diameter of the winding roll is equal to the outer diameter of the feeding roll. 14. The head maintenance device according to claim 13 , wherein the belt-shaped member is fed from the feeding roller to the winding roller via a guide roller, and a pair of conveyance rollers. 15. The head maintenance device according to claim 14 , wherein a pressing member which presses the belt-shaped member against an object to be wiped is disposed between the pair of conveyance rollers.
